Computer Access/Dorm

Four computers and one printer have been installed in the study hall of the student dormitory for use by all students. From here, students can access Email, Internet, Borland Library for Medline searches, and Word for composing memos, documents, etc.

WIRELESS INSTRUCTIONS

To connect your laptop to the wireless network in the dormitory:

  • When viewing wireless networks available in the area on your laptop, select the network called "Guest".
  • At the prompt, enter your email address.

Your connection to the internet through the wireless network should then be established.
